Hi,
the following sentence works under ksh88, mksh and bash,
but doesn't under ksh93 :
/opt/ast/bin/ksh -c 'function foo {
typeset rc=0; unset -f foo; return $rc;
}; foo'
Segmentation fault
/opt/ast/bin/ksh --version
version sh (AT&T Research) 93u 2011-02-08
doesn't work also under RHEL r and s+ release.
this one seems to work :
/opt/ast/bin/ksh -c 'function foo { unset -f foo; }; foo'
but not this one too (segfault under cygwin,
but ok, from memory, under RHEL 5.2 and 5.4) :
/opt/ast/bin/ksh -c 'function foo { unset -f foo; return 0; }; foo'
Segmentation fault
